aboutsummaryrefslogtreecommitdiff
path: root/tests/test/script/runner
AgeCommit message (Expand)AuthorFilesLines
2017-05-03Fix test failures caused by previous commitBoris Kolpackov1-0/+4
2017-05-02Cleanup testscript runner diagnosticsBoris Kolpackov6-36/+30
2017-05-01Add hxx extension for headersKaren Arutyunov1-4/+4
2017-03-16Add support for >! test command redirectKaren Arutyunov1-0/+47
2017-03-15Print sub-entries of non-empty testscript directory registered for cleanupKaren Arutyunov1-3/+22
2017-03-15Add support for config.test.output variableKaren Arutyunov2-1/+88
2017-03-15Print unexpected or regex non-matching test command stdout/stderrKaren Arutyunov2-0/+7
2017-03-02Implement parallel matchBoris Kolpackov1-1/+1
2017-03-01Add set builtinKaren Arutyunov2-1/+276
2017-02-11Add support for &dir/*[*][/] test path cleanup syntaxKaren Arutyunov1-35/+104
2017-02-10Fix save_regex()Karen Arutyunov2-30/+49
2017-01-31Move builtin and runner tests to '$c ... && $b' patternKaren Arutyunov4-254/+102
2017-01-31Add support for test command pipe, expression and command-ifKaren Arutyunov5-43/+593
2017-01-24Add support for shared here-documentsKaren Arutyunov1-0/+19
2017-01-24Add support for comparison of test command output to a fileKaren Arutyunov2-17/+39
2017-01-19Add support for portable path modifer and dot character escaping inversionKaren Arutyunov6-323/+763
2017-01-09Make use of operator<<(ostream, exception)Karen Arutyunov1-12/+3
2017-01-05Update copyright yearBoris Kolpackov5-5/+5
2017-01-05Tests cleanupKaren Arutyunov3-542/+573
2017-01-05Print signal/core dump like shell/makeKaren Arutyunov2-12/+99
2017-01-05Save diff output for {stdout,stderr}.diffKaren Arutyunov2-17/+47
2017-01-05Add support for regex in runnerKaren Arutyunov4-96/+320
2016-12-16Convert tests/ to subproject, initial work on cross-testing supportBoris Kolpackov4-40/+46
2016-12-05Make use of casts and canonicalizations in testscriptsKaren Arutyunov2-35/+37
2016-12-01Implement testscript variable-ifBoris Kolpackov1-1/+1
2016-12-01Organize tests/, factor common testscript fragmentsBoris Kolpackov2-23/+5
2016-11-30Add support for typed/untyped concatenated expansionBoris Kolpackov2-2/+2
2016-11-25Implement literal here-document supportBoris Kolpackov2-4/+4
2016-11-22Fix typoBoris Kolpackov2-2/+2
2016-11-21Change build.driver/path variable to build.path/process_pathBoris Kolpackov2-2/+2
2016-11-15Add cat, false and true builtinsKaren Arutyunov5-99/+6
2016-11-08Add mkdir and touch builtinsKaren Arutyunov6-67/+306
2016-11-04Fix Clang and VC warningsKaren Arutyunov1-2/+5
2016-11-04Make rmdir_r() to call entry_exists(path) rather than exists(dir_path)Karen Arutyunov1-0/+8
2016-11-04Add support for cleanup types to testscript runnerKaren Arutyunov1-41/+56
2016-11-04Check if registered for cleanup path is in test scope working directoryKaren Arutyunov1-1/+27
2016-11-04Add support for &dir/*** test path cleanup syntaxKaren Arutyunov1-9/+91
2016-11-04Update testscriptsBoris Kolpackov2-1/+21
2016-11-04Add support of paths cleanups to testscript runnerKaren Arutyunov3-1/+28
2016-11-04Add support of merge redirect to testscript runnerKaren Arutyunov3-9/+35
2016-11-04Add support of file redirects to testscript runnerKaren Arutyunov2-3/+11
2016-11-04Add support of file redirects to testscript parserKaren Arutyunov1-0/+2
2016-11-04Support paths cleanup when test scope is leftKaren Arutyunov1-0/+4
2016-11-04Fix printing no-newline here-doc and here-strKaren Arutyunov2-19/+54
2016-11-04Rename tests/test/script/ to tests/test/script/runner/Boris Kolpackov3-0/+155